Gor Mahia vs Tusker’s’clash on Sunday 28th May 2023 will be one of the most brutal matches in FKF Premier League history.

With only four matches to the end of the season, Tusker one points lead does not make them much comfortable at the KPL summit. A win for Gor Mahia will place them on top of the table with twoa point while Tusker’s win puts them comfortably in the title race.

Tusker leads the league logs on 64 points, one above second-placed Gor Both teams are aiming for the title with Tusker two points lead on the table.

K’Ogalo head coach Jonathan McKinstry has expressed confidence in their ability to run over champions Tusker on their way to a 20th Kenyan Premier League title.

But his tactics have been on test with many K’Ogalo followers questioning on his squad selection. The Irish tactician’s style of play is mostly defensive as observed by many Gor Mahia fans. But the head coach has urged his charges to push above and beyond to prevail over their opponents in the crunch encounter.

Gor Mahia striker Benson Omalla

“We are eager to win our next match against Tusker. Losing is unimaginable. That would be too costly for us. Our focus is on delivering the 20th title this season. It would be catastrophic to crash to Tusker on Sunday,” McKinstry said during an interview with Star Newspaper.

“The morale in the camp ahead of the match is encouraging. The players have responded very well in training sessions and the energy they display is amazing,” he added.

Matano on the other hand has vowed to dismantle tactical K’Ogalo with his scheming tactic. His always-attacking football will be witnessed on Sunday at Nyayo Stadium. He has confirmed they are prepared enough for the match and are confident to sail through on the Sunday vital match

“We hope to reap maximum points from the game. We know Gor are good and well organized and so we are doing everything we can to prepare well for them,” Matano said.

In their first leg encounter, Gor Mahia won 2-1 in a match played at Moi International Sports Center – Kasarani with Benson Omalla scoring K’Ogalo scoring the winning goal (read Gor Mahia beats Tusker 2-1 at Kasarani)

Omalla leads the Golden Boot race with 25 goals but has endured goal drought for the last three games.

The kick-Off time will be at 3:00 PM.
